Utilizes The Din 43589-1 Form Factor, Which Has Been Specially Configured For North American Fast Charging Systems - Awg/Mm Contacts & Tooling - Up To 4 Auxiliary Contacts - Can Be Used For Battery Monitoring & Charging - Low Mating Forces - Connectors Can Be Mated & Unmated Without The Necessity Of Added Hardware - Hexagonal Voltage Key For 24, 36, 48, 72, 80 & 96V - Key Prevents Mating Of Different Operating Voltages - 'A' Series Connectors Are For American Wire Gauge Cable & Mee: Din -Norm/Din-Standard Din43589 Includes: Housing Contact Holder Voltage Key Cable Clamp Screws
Checklist Caddy helps promote Operator Safety. Checklist Caddy includes 75 sets of two-part carbonless forms that ensure that one copy remains with the machine at all times when the other is handed to the supervisor each shift. Checklist log helps ensure the proper flow of communication on safety or maintenance issues and helps meet OSHA compliance for pre-operational inspections. Each caddy comes in a hard plastic case that can be mounted inside the driver's compartment for easy access and protection. One pen with plastic attachment wire is also included.
